Weather in October

October, the same as September, is a moderately hot autumn month in Horseshoe, Florida, with an average temperature varying between 80.6°F (27°C) and 64.9°F (18.3°C).

Temperature

Horseshoe's progression into October involves a gentle drop in the average high-temperature, from a tropical 87.1°F (30.6°C) in September to a moderately hot 80.6°F (27°C). An average low-temperature of 64.9°F (18.3°C) is recorded during the nights in October in Horseshoe.

Heat index

The heat index in October is appraised at 84.2°F (29°C). Enduring exposure and continuous activity might cause a feeling of tiredness and induce heat cramps.
Heat index readings emphasize conditions of light breezes and shaded spots. The heat index has the possibility to be enhanced by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ees when there is dire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', is a composite of temperature and humidity figures to convey how warm it feels. The influence of weather is personal, differing among a variety of individuals based on differences in body mass, stature, and the level of physical activity. It is essential to be conscious of the fact that direct sunlight can intensify the felt heat, leading to an elevation in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are of high significance for children. Young ones regularly neglect the requirement for rest and fluid replenishment. Thirst is a late stage of dehydration - so, it is necessary to keep hydrated, particularly during extended periods of physical exertion.

Humidity

In October, the average relative humidity is 74%.

Rainfall

In October, in Horseshoe, the rain falls for 9.7 days. Throughout October, 1.1" (28m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 144.9 rainfall days, and 16.14" (410m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through November are months without snowfall in Horseshoe.

Daylight

The average length of the day in October is 11h and 27min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:26 am and sunset at 7:18 pm. On the last day of October, sunrise is at 7:46 am and sunset at 6:47 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Horseshoe, the average sunshine in October is 7.7h.

UV index

In Horseshoe, the average daily maximum UV index in October is 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 6 in October converts into the following recommendations:
Persist with safeguards and heed sun safety doctrines. Keeping sunburn at bay is of prime importance. Seek shade and minimize exposure to direct Sun in a period between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. when UV radiation is most intense; ke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not provide perfect sun protection. For holistic sun protection encompassing the eyes, ears, face, and neck, a wide-brim hat is key.
